STEWART, Samuel 2 3 4 5 6

  • Born: Mar 1852, Perth County, Ontario, Canada
  • Marriage: PETHERICK, Naomi on 15 Jun 1876 in Listowel, Perth County, Ontario, Canada 1
  • Died: After 1930, Royal Oak, Oakland County, Michigan

picture

Samuel married Naomi PETHERICK, daughter of John PETHERICK and Jane SLOCOMBE, on 15 Jun 1876 in Listowel, Perth County, Ontario, Canada.1 (Naomi PETHERICK was born in Sep 1853 in Devonshire, England and died in 1900-1910 in Detroit, Wayne County, Michigan.)

2 1900 US Census (District 214, Detroit Ward 12, Wayne County, Michigan). Repository: Ancestry. Surety: 4. Lists Samuel Stewart (age 48, b. Mar 1852, Canada), wife Naomi [Pethwick] (age 46, b. Sep 1853, England) and children Arthur (age 22, b. Nov 1877, Canada), Charles A. (age 20, b. Jul 1880, MI), Francis L. (age 17, b. Sep 1882, MI), Margaret J. (age 15, b. Jul 1884, MI), Edna R. (age 11, b. Nov 1888, MI), Samuel E. (age 6, b. Jun 1893, MI) and Sarah N. (age 4, b. Jun 1895, MI), living in Detroit, Michigan. Samuel is listed as a "teamster," and indicates that both his parents were born in Ireland. Naomi indicates that both her parents were born in England. Arthur is listed as a "pressman." Charles is listed as a "clerk." Samuel Sr., Naomi and Arthur indicate that they immigrated to the U.S. in 1879 and are naturalized. Samuel and Naomi indicate that they have been married for 24 years, and have had 8 children, 7 of whom are still living.

3 1910 US Census (District 78, Detroit Ward 5, Wayne County, Michigan). Surety: 4. Lists Samuel Stewart (age 58, b. Canada), widower, and children Francis (age 27, b. MI), Margaret (age 25, b. MI), Edna (age 21, b. MI), Everett (age 16, b. MI) and Sarah (age 14, b. MI), living in Detroit, Michigan. Also in the household is Louise Pethwick (age 18, b. MI), who is likely the niece of Samuel's deceased wife. Samuel is listed as a "laborer, street," and indicates that both his parents were born in Ireland. Francis is listed as a "stenographer, auto factory." Edna is listed as a "stenographer, adding machine." Everett is listed as a "machinist, machine shop." Samuel indicates that he immigrated to the U.S. in 1878 and is naturalized. He also indicates that he has been widowed for 5 years. Louise Pethwick indicates that her father was born in England and her mother in Canada (Scotch).

4 1880 US Census (District 235, Richland, Montcalm County, Michigan). Repository: Ancestry. Surety: 4. Lists Samuel Stewart (age 27, b. Canada), wife Naomi [Pethwick] (age 27, b. Canada [erroneous]) and children Arthur (age 2, b. Canada) and Charles (age 5 mos, b. Jan 1880, MI), living in Richland, Michigan. Samuel is listed as a "farmer," and indicates that both his parents were born in Ireland. Naomi indicates that both her parents were born in England. Living next door is Arthur Stewart (age 40, b. Ireland) and his family, whose relationship is still unclear.

5 1920 US Census, District 198, Royal Oak, Oakland County, Michigan. Surety: 4. Lists Samuel Stewart (age 66, b. Canada), widower, and children Frances (age 29, b. MI), Everett (age 26, b. MI) and Naomi (age 23, b. MI), living in Royal Oak, Michigan. Samuel is listed as a "laborer, factory," and indicates that both his father was born in Ireland and his mother in Canada [erroneous]. He also indicates that he immigrated to the U.S. in 1888 and was naturalized in 1895. Everett is listed as a "laborer, factory." Naomi is listed as an "office clerk, bank."

6 1930 US Census, District 99, Royal Oak, Oakland County, Michigan. Surety: 4. Lists Robert L. Smith (age 36, b. MI), wife Francis L. [Stewart] (age 45, b. MI) and children [from Robert's first marriage] Charles (age 14, b. Eng. Canada), William (age 12, b. MI) and [from this marriage] Robert (age 7, b. MI), living in Royal Oak, Michigan. Also in the household is Francis' father, Samuel Stewart (age 76, b. Eng. Canada). Robert Sr. is listed as a "carpenter, building," and indicates that both his parents were born in Michigan. All the children also indicate that both their parents were born in Michigan. Samuel is listed as "odd jobs, anything," and indicates that both his parents were born in Ireland. Samuel indicates that he immigrated to the U.S. in 1872. The record indicates that Francis and Robert have been married for about 9 years.
